Transaction 20992c887c61d62371449de44405261424378cc284ffe635b8294910606ec80a
1 Input
1 Output
-
20992c887c61d62371449de44405261424378cc284ffe635b8294910606ec80a:0
- value
- 13041240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dcb6541e0e573e456ca34b869550994855a06e7 OP_EQUAL
- address
- 3LTA73CASyi3usKFAyeNedhpoGDp84CgS1